new purchase
 
Okay, so I just got myself a 356!

I have owned a 911SC and a 993 but never a 356. My first question is - do I check the oil the same way as I did with the other two?? Temp needs to be warm and dipstick checked with engine running?

Second, what about gas? Super?

I am sure I will have many more questions... thanks in advance.

id10t 10-24-2003 06:22 AM

I check my oil about 20 minutes after shutting down. You want it to have time to drip down into the sump.

For gas, use whatever you like, as long as it doesn't ping. Harry Pellow, (considered to be a 356 god) liked whatever Chevron was passing off as "gas" in California.

You may also want to subscribe ot the 356 Registry's (www.356registry.org) listserv 356Talk.

So you check the oil with the engine off??

cassisrot 10-24-2003 01:02 PM

I guess 356's do not have dry sump lubrication (oil tank) like 911's, which would mean you need to let the oil collect before checking it. Is that correct?

cassisrot 10-24-2003 01:16 PM

Oh, Congrats, pictures.

atlporsche 10-24-2003 01:54 PM

that is correct...912's are the same way. check the oil level cold. I check mine before taking it out every time.
